BIRMINGHAM: Plenty of excitement is expected this weekend for the AHSAA to close out the 2026 basketball season with state championship play from Legacy Arena at the BJCC.
Gameday Weekly is providing the daily schedule for Friday and Saturday with 12 championships to take place March 6 & 7.
Friday, March 6:
2A G: Cold Springs (23 & 10) vs. NSM (26 & 9) 9:00
2A: Lafayette (26 & 7) vs. Section (24 & 10) 10:45
3A G: St. James (32 & 4) vs. Mobile Chr (21 & 10) 12:30
3A: Montgomery Acad (27 & 7) vs. SS Selma (22 & 6)
4A G: Good Hope (29 & 5) vs. Plainview (34 & 2) 4:00
4A: Fairfield (25 & 10) vs. Ashville (31 & 3) 5:45
Saturday, March 7:
5A G: Guntersville (33 & 4) vs. Moody (21 & 10) 9:00
5A: Sylacauga (30 & 2) vs. Wenonah (27 & 5) 10:45
6A G: Hazel Green (31 & 2) vs. Park Crossing (32 & 3)
6A: Cullman (27 & 5) vs. Oxford (29 & 4) 2:15
7A: Bob Jones (25 & 6) vs. TBD 4:00
7A: Tuscaloosa Co (28 & 5) vs. TBD 5:45
The Cold Springs, Good Hope and Cullman games will air live on 92.1 FM (WKUL).
